Hi,
Following the loss of half my peers last week (thank you to all that
added me afterwards). I wondered just what the state of peer
connectivity was. So I wrote an application to find out.
I started with the servers currently in the pool from
https://sks-keyservers.net/status/
Then queried each active server in turn with /pks/lookup?op=stats
I ended up with the attached diagram.
There were 34 active servers. The average number of peers per server
is 12. But there are a handful of servers with only 1 or 2 peers. I
did not find any islands.
(I ignored the peers with RFC 1918 addresses and servers that did not
respond when I made the measurements).
